Beardsley: I feel it’s additionally cool — I’ve talked to numerous pals when we have now board recreation nights the place you verify in on bandwidth and it’s like, “OK, we’re not going to play the sport that takes 5 hours.” You possibly can have it make sense to your life, you are able to do check-ins and morph what the grasp goes to appear like so you possibly can preserve it going.

Mulligan: And I might say, flexibility, but in addition flexibility with some resilience to flakiness. Somebody can’t make it last-minute? Nonetheless do it, have a contingency. One time, when somebody couldn’t make it to our 14-year residence recreation — it was the form of marketing campaign the place with out one particular person there, it is unnecessary to play. So we did a associated one-shot in that world with brand-new characters constructed that weekend.

As a result of it’s a dying spiral. Somebody flakes and we are saying, “All proper, nicely, let’s push it off to subsequent week.” Subsequent week rolls round, the day earlier than, “Hey guys, are we certain we’re doing it?” And somebody’s feeling slightly below the climate, in order that they’re like, “Ahh, I don’t assume I can do it tomorrow.” After which individuals go, “I’m clearing my Thursday evenings for a factor that by no means occurs.” And it falls aside. Do it. Even when somebody can’t make it, get collectively.
